Is there a way to screen for a student in the admissions process for whom TBL is indeed the right fit? As part of our Physician Assistant Studies Program admissions process at the MGH Institute of Health Professions, potential students are placed in random teams and asked to participate in an imaginative team application exercise. Trained facilitators observe the applicants as they discuss and negotiate in their teams, and using a scoring rubric, grade both positive and negative team behaviors. This two-hour interactive workshop will include a hands-on experience of our simulated group process, an explanation of our rubric, and an opportunity to test inter-rater reliability of the rubric. Pre-reading will be assessed with a brief IRAT/TRAT, and discussion will encourage workshop participants to apply our piloted approach to their unique situations.
